Description

General part information

SN74AVC2T45 Series

This 2-bit non-inverting bus transceiver uses two separate configurable power-supply rails. The A ports are designed to track VCCA and accepts any supply voltage from 1.2V to 3.6V. The B ports are designed to track VCCB and accepts any supply voltage from 1.2V to 3.6V. This allows for universal low-voltage bidirectional translation and level-shifting between any of the 1.2V, 1.5V, 1.8V, 2.5V, and 3.3V voltage nodes.

The SN74AVC2T45 is designed for asynchronous communication between two data buses. The logic levels of the direction-control (DIR pin) input activate either the B-port outputs or the A-port outputs. The device transmits data from the A bus to the B bus when the B-port outputs are activated and from the B bus to the A bus when the A-port outputs are activated. The input circuitry on both A and B ports always is active and must have a logic HIGH or LOW level applied to prevent excess leakage current on the internal CMOS structure.
